Qwik 项目教程
项目介绍
Qwik 是一个为边缘计算重新设计的框架,旨在提供高性能和即时响应的 Web 应用。它通过避免不必要的 JavaScript 执行来优化性能,特别适用于需要快速加载和交互的场景。
项目快速启动
安装 Qwik
首先,确保你已经安装了 Node.js 和 npm。然后,使用以下命令安装 Qwik CLI:
npm install -g @builder.io/qwik
创建新项目
使用 Qwik CLI 创建一个新的 Qwik 项目:
qwik create my-qwik-app
cd my-qwik-app
启动开发服务器
在项目目录中,启动开发服务器:
npm start
现在,你可以在浏览器中访问 http://localhost:3000
查看你的 Qwik 应用。
应用案例和最佳实践
应用案例
Qwik 已被用于构建多种类型的 Web 应用,包括电子商务网站、新闻门户和内部管理工具。其快速加载和响应特性使得用户体验得到显著提升。
最佳实践
- 懒加载组件:使用 Qwik 的懒加载功能来减少初始加载时间。
- 优化资源:确保所有静态资源(如图片和脚本)都经过优化。
- 使用 Qwik 的钩子:利用 Qwik 提供的生命周期钩子来管理组件状态和数据加载。
典型生态项目
Qwik City
Qwik City 是一个基于 Qwik 的框架,用于构建复杂的单页应用(SPA)。它提供了路由、状态管理和组件库等功能。
Qwik + Vite
Vite 是一个现代的前端构建工具,与 Qwik 结合使用可以进一步提升开发体验和应用性能。
Qwik + RxJS
Qwik 与 RxJS 结合使用,可以实现响应式编程,使得数据流管理更加高效和直观。
通过以上内容,你可以快速了解并开始使用 Qwik 项目,同时掌握其最佳实践和生态项目。